Transaction 95e9217192253f93cc07cd6d6ef7cbb8e0ce41a42590d7718c7c81ff0355e876

1 Input
2 Outputs
  • 95e9217192253f93cc07cd6d6ef7cbb8e0ce41a42590d7718c7c81ff0355e876:0
  • value  3294200
    address  32M3jbucMVa1KjGQJ2jYz5ESiYHEJ9VjhL
  • 95e9217192253f93cc07cd6d6ef7cbb8e0ce41a42590d7718c7c81ff0355e876:1
  • value  2656772
    address  39LdxkThSabjmpn2X5fmg6XkzLPzPRA4nW